sequelize-ts-boilerplate
Advanced tools
Comparing version
@@ -112,4 +112,4 @@ "use strict"; | ||
myImportRefStatement = `import { ${general_utils_1.default.capitalizeFirstLetter(y.reference.model)} } from './${general_utils_1.default.capitalizeFirstLetter(y.reference.model)}';`; | ||
myPropertyRefStatement = `// insert bc of one:many- so can query ${general_utils_1.default.capitalizeFirstLetter(x.tableName)}.find({include: [${general_utils_1.default.capitalizeFirstLetter(y.reference.model)}]})` + | ||
+`\t@BelongsTo(() => ${general_utils_1.default.capitalizeFirstLetter(y.reference.model)}) \n` | ||
myPropertyRefStatement = `\t// insert bc of one:many- so can query ${general_utils_1.default.capitalizeFirstLetter(x.tableName)}.find({include: [${general_utils_1.default.capitalizeFirstLetter(y.reference.model)}]})\n` | ||
+ `\t@BelongsTo(() => ${general_utils_1.default.capitalizeFirstLetter(y.reference.model)}) \n` | ||
+ `\tpublic ${y.reference.lowerCaseModel}: ${general_utils_1.default.capitalizeFirstLetter(y.reference.model)};\n`; | ||
@@ -116,0 +116,0 @@ write({ myImportRefStatement, myPropertyRefStatement, filename }); |
@@ -151,3 +151,3 @@ import path = require("path"); | ||
myImportRefStatement = `import { ${utils.capitalizeFirstLetter(y.reference.model)} } from './${utils.capitalizeFirstLetter(y.reference.model) }';`; | ||
myPropertyRefStatement = `// insert bc of one:many- so can query ${utils.capitalizeFirstLetter(x.tableName)}.find({include: [${utils.capitalizeFirstLetter(y.reference.model)}]})` + | ||
myPropertyRefStatement = `\t// insert bc of one:many- so can query ${utils.capitalizeFirstLetter(x.tableName)}.find({include: [${utils.capitalizeFirstLetter(y.reference.model)}]})\n` | ||
+ `\t@BelongsTo(() => ${utils.capitalizeFirstLetter(y.reference.model)}) \n` | ||
@@ -154,0 +154,0 @@ + `\tpublic ${y.reference.lowerCaseModel}: ${utils.capitalizeFirstLetter(y.reference.model)};\n`; |
{ | ||
"name": "sequelize-ts-boilerplate", | ||
"version": "0.0.39", | ||
"version": "0.0.40", | ||
"description": "A REST API scaffolding tool designed to scale and easily generate CRUD endpoints based on database schema design", | ||
@@ -5,0 +5,0 @@ "main": "build/index.js", |
Sorry, the diff of this file is not supported yet
1264486
7.09%557
9%17004
8.35%